JP McMahon and Drigin Gaffey announce closure of Tartare

August 20, 2022 by Ivan Brincat Leave a Comment

GALWAY: JP McMahon, a leading Irish chef that has helped to place Ireland on the global culinary map with his restaurant Aniar and one of the best food events in the world Food on the Edge has announced the closure of Tartare after five years. In a press statement, JP said running three restaurants has been very difficult since COVID-19. He said he particularly found the shortage of good quality chefs very challenging. "Energy and labour costs have spiralled in 2022 and the sustainability of our business is challenging. With having the other two restaurants, running Food on the Edge, alongside other commitments, I felt we had to consolidate and focus on the bigger picture," he said. "It is with sadness that we announce that we will be closing our beautiful Tartare on 4 September," JP McMahon said. "We are very proud of what we achieved over the past 5 years. ‘CODA is my point of view on desserts. It is the beginning of something great for the pastry world’ – René Frank 

August 18, 2022 by Ivan Brincat Leave a Comment

René Frank: Setting the bar for pastry chefs around the world BERLIN: Pastry chef René Frank is riding the crest of the wave. Just last month, he was recognised as the best pastry chef in the world. But that is the last in a series of awards and accolades that he has been clinching since completing his training as a pastry chef in 2004. He's worked around the world but he is mostly known for creating a two Michelin star dessert restaurant in Berlin, the first ever such restaurant in Germany and one of very few such restaurants in the world. So what's it like to have a dessert restaurant? Is it just for customers with a sweet-tooth only? In this interview, we ask René to explain his vision, the challenges of opening such a restaurant, why such a restaurant in Germany could only work in Berlin and why he thinks we will be seeing similar concepts in future.
